Forme abrégée de vérification des valeurs falsy en JavaScript
Supposons maintenant que nous voulons vérifier si la valeur d'une variable est falsy. Cela peut être fait de la manière suivante :
let test = true;
if (test === false) {
console.log('+++');
} else {
console.log('---');
}
On peut aussi écrire un code équivalent avec une négation :
let test = true;
if (test !== true) {
console.log('+++');
} else {
console.log('---');
}
Le code présenté peut être réécrit sous une forme abrégée comme suit :
let test = true;
if (!test) {
console.log('+++');
} else {
console.log('---');
}
Réécrivez le code suivant en utilisant la forme abrégée :
let test = true;
if (test == false) {
console.log('+++');
} else {
console.log('---');
}
Réécrivez le code suivant en utilisant la forme abrégée :
let test = true;
if (test != true) {
console.log('+++');
} else {
console.log('---');
}
Réécrivez le code suivant en utilisant la forme abrégée :
let test = true;
if (test != false) {
console.log('+++');
} else {
console.log('---');
}